Transaction ed085ebdf1949f0060fb9632a1cea39b92ee7b47fa372782a414109af8dc7477

block
026e67e11baa68fc875a02644ec28124200be40edc41baa9a9d6f04b4a02d21e

1 Input

23 Outputs